PHP驱动大数据:实时处理的高效赋能之道
|
PHP作为一种广泛使用的服务器端脚本语言,传统上被认为更适合于Web开发和小型应用。然而,随着大数据时代的到来,PHP在实时数据处理中的潜力逐渐被挖掘出来。通过合理的架构设计和工具选择,PHP可以高效地参与到大数据处理流程中。
AI模拟效果图,仅供参考 实时数据处理对性能和响应速度有极高的要求。PHP本身具备快速执行的能力,特别是在使用如HHVM(HipHop Virtual Machine)等优化工具时,能够显著提升代码执行效率。这使得PHP在处理高并发、低延迟的数据流时表现出色。 在大数据场景中,PHP通常与其他技术栈结合使用,例如与Apache Kafka、RabbitMQ等消息队列系统集成,实现数据的异步处理。这种方式不仅提升了系统的可扩展性,也降低了单点故障的风险,使整个数据处理流程更加稳定。 PHP拥有丰富的库和框架支持,如Laravel、Symfony等,这些框架提供了强大的数据处理功能和良好的开发体验。开发者可以通过这些工具快速构建出高效的大数据处理模块,而无需从零开始设计。 对于需要实时分析的业务场景,PHP还可以与NoSQL数据库如MongoDB或Elasticsearch配合使用,实现快速的数据检索和分析。这种组合能够满足对实时性要求较高的应用场景,如用户行为分析、实时监控等。 站长个人见解,PHP在大数据领域的应用并非局限于传统的Web开发,它同样可以在实时处理中发挥重要作用。通过合理的技术选型和架构设计,PHP能够为大数据处理提供高效的赋能,成为现代数据驱动应用的重要组成部分。 (编辑:91站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

